Highlights
Are people in Idaho Falls older or younger than people in Sugar City?
- The Median Age in Idaho Falls is 4.2 years older than in Sugar City.

Are housing costs cheaper in Idaho Falls or Sugar City?
- Idaho Falls housing costs are 3.0% less expensive than Sugar City hous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Idaho Falls or Sugar City?
- The average commute for residents of Idaho Falls is 3.5 minutes longer than it is for residents of Sugar City.
